    It seemed to him as if some one was calling him. He arose and dressed him-self and awoke the little boy. He told the boy to saddle the horse that he had to go to aid the dying. The man of the house hearing the noise arose and then he saw the priest making ready to go a journey. He presuaded him to stay and not to go out into such a storm but it was of no avail. The priest and the boy set off. They reached a high cliff. Here the priest dismounted. He left the horse in charge of the little boy and told him that he was going to decend the cliff as he was needed to aid the dying. The boy remained at the head of cliff while the priest desended. The little boy now became aware that some one was dying and that was why the priest came out such a stormy night.
